{"paper":{"title":"Minimal immersions of closed surfaces in hyperbolic three-manifolds","license":"http://arxiv.org/licenses/nonexclusive-distrib/1.0/","headline":"","cross_cats":["math.AP","math.GT"],"primary_cat":"math.DG","authors_text":"Marcello Lucia, Zheng Huang","submitted_at":"2010-11-05T02:41:01Z","abstract_excerpt":"We study minimal immersions of closed surfaces (of genus $g \\ge 2$) in hyperbolic 3-manifolds, with prescribed data $(\\sigma, t\\alpha)$, where $\\sigma$ is a conformal structure on a topological surface $S$, and $\\alpha dz^2$ is a holomorphic quadratic differential on the surface $(S,\\sigma)$. We show that, for each $t \\in (0,\\tau_0)$ for some $\\tau_0 > 0$, depending only on $(\\sigma, \\alpha)$, there are at least two minimal immersions of closed surface of prescribed second fundamental form $Re(t\\alpha)$ in the conformal structure $\\sigma$.
